Situation - Owermoigne is a charming and sought-after Dorset village nestled within attractive countryside between Dorchester and the Jurassic Coast. Offering a peaceful rural setting, the village benefits from a welcoming community, a historic church and convenient access to nearby amenities. The surrounding area is renowned for its picturesque landscapes, scenic walking and riding routes, and easy access to the coastal destinations of Weymouth, Lulworth Cove and Durdle Door. Excellent road links provide connections to Dorchester, Wareham and beyond, making Owermoigne an ideal location for those seeking a balance of country living and accessibility.
